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County)
With 133 people,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County) is a city in California. 53% of adults hold a bachelor's degree, against 24% nationally. Since 2009 the city has more than tripled, up 102 people. Median home value sits at $233,300. At a median age of 42.3, this is an older place than the country as a whole. 60% of homes are owner-occupied.

How many people live in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California?
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California has about 133 residents according to the 2000 Census.
What is the median household income in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California?
The typical household in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California earns about $49,583 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California expensive?
In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California, the median home is worth about $233,300, and the typical rent is about $600 a month.
How educated are people in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California?
About 53.2% of adults age 25 and over in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California?
About 8.1% of people in Bear Valley CDP (Alpine County), California live below the federal poverty line.
